At a Glance
- Tasks: Lead non-functional testing, focusing on performance, scalability, and security validation.
- Company: Join a major UK client in a transformative Quality Assurance programme.
- Benefits: Enjoy a hybrid work model with potential for contract extension.
- Why this job: Be part of an innovative team driving quality in a dynamic tech environment.
- Qualifications: Experience in non-functional testing and CI/CD integration is essential.
- Other info: Clearance: BPSS required; hands-on role with a focus on automation.
The predicted salary is between 48000 - 72000 £ per year.
We are hiring multiple NFT Leads to help drive a flagship multi-year Quality Assurance transformation programme for a major UK client. As part of a SAFe Agile delivery, this is a hands-on, technical role — not just coordination. You will own the design and execution of non-functional tests covering performance, scalability, failover, and security validation. You’ll be building automation libraries, executing scenario-based testing, and providing clear data-led insights to readiness gates and go-live decisions.
What you'll do:
- Design & execute performance, scalability, failover, and soak tests
- Run load and resilience testing to validate system behaviour under stress
- Manage NFT artefacts and dashboards aligned to release decision points
- Drive automation uplift and reusable test libraries into CI/CD pipelines
- Ensure monitoring & environment alignment for NFT accuracy
- Integrate security testing: threat modelling, vulnerability, and penetration testing
- Support ITHC readiness, operational acceptance (OAT), and recovery test walkthroughs
- Collaborate with DevOps, infrastructure, automation, and client teams
- Track and document failure patterns and regressions across test stages
What you'll bring:
- Strong experience in non-functional testing: performance, failover, and resilience
- Ability to build risk-based test scenarios, not just run template scripts
- Skilled in tracking and analysing performance regressions
- Strong CI/CD mindset: integrate NFT into DevOps pipelines
- Ability to work closely with triage teams and provide decisive test data
- Hands-on security validation and ITHC preparation experience
Tech environment:
- Must-have:
- Test & Reporting: qTest, Jira, Xray, Allure, Confluence
- CI/CD & Build: Jenkins, GitLab CI/CD, Git, Gradle
- NFT Tools: NeoLoad, JMeter, BlazeMeter, OWASP ZAP, SonarQube, Burp Suite, SQLMap, Nmap, Lighthouse, Prometheus, Grafana, Snyk
- Selenium, Playwright, Serenity BDD, Cucumber, Postman, REST Assured
- Gatling, RedLine13
All our roles are UK based.
Non Functional Test NFT Lead employer: Colossus Recruitment
Contact Detail:
Colossus Recruitment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Non Functional Test NFT Lead
✨Tip Number 1
Familiarise yourself with the specific tools mentioned in the job description, such as NeoLoad, JMeter, and OWASP ZAP. Having hands-on experience or even a solid understanding of these tools will give you an edge during discussions.
✨Tip Number 2
Showcase your ability to integrate non-functional testing into CI/CD pipelines. Be prepared to discuss how you've successfully implemented automation in previous roles, as this is a key aspect of the position.
✨Tip Number 3
Highlight any experience you have with Agile methodologies, particularly SAFe. Being able to demonstrate your understanding of Agile practices will resonate well with the hiring team.
✨Tip Number 4
Prepare to discuss real-world scenarios where you've tracked and analysed performance regressions. Concrete examples will help illustrate your problem-solving skills and technical expertise.
We think you need these skills to ace Non Functional Test NFT Lead
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ience in non-functional testing, particularly in performance, scalability, and security validation. Use specific examples that demonstrate your hands-on technical skills and familiarity with the tools mentioned in the job description.
Craft a Strong Cover Letter: Write a cover letter that clearly outlines your motivation for applying to this role. Emphasise your ability to design and execute non-functional tests and your experience with CI/CD pipelines. Mention how you can contribute to the Quality Assurance transformation programme.
Highlight Relevant Tools and Technologies: In your application, specifically mention your proficiency with tools like NeoLoad, JMeter, and Jenkins. This will show that you have the necessary technical background to succeed in the role.
Proofread Your Application: Before submitting, carefully proofread your CV and cover letter for any spelling or grammatical errors. Ensure that all your contact information is correct and that you've removed any confidential details as requested.
How to prepare for a job interview at Colossus Recruitment
✨Showcase Your Technical Skills
Make sure to highlight your hands-on experience with non-functional testing tools like NeoLoad, JMeter, and OWASP ZAP. Be prepared to discuss specific projects where you designed and executed performance or security tests.
✨Demonstrate Your CI/CD Knowledge
Since the role requires a strong CI/CD mindset, be ready to explain how you've integrated non-functional testing into DevOps pipelines. Share examples of how you've used tools like Jenkins or GitLab CI/CD in your previous roles.
✨Prepare for Scenario-Based Questions
Expect questions that assess your ability to build risk-based test scenarios. Think of examples where you identified potential risks and how you designed tests to mitigate them, rather than just running template scripts.
✨Communicate Clearly and Collaboratively
This role involves collaboration with various teams, so practice articulating your thoughts clearly. Be ready to discuss how you've worked with DevOps, infrastructure, and client teams to drive successful testing outcomes.